In June 1580, he was arrested on landing at Dover, and committed to the Gatehouse, Westminster. On 4 December, he was transferred to the Tower, where he was subjected to the torture known as the "
Scavenger's Daughter" for more than an hour on 9 December. Luke Kirby was tried at the same time as
Edmund Campion, on the same charge of treason against the Queen, but his execution was deferred to the following May, and took place immediately after that of
William Filby. == Execution ==
